Caerphilly Fast Forward, formerly the New Deal Unit offers a friendly, supportive, practical-based learning environment for people who would like to build on their existing skills, try out work placements and work towards nationally recognised qualifications. Although based in Blackwood, our services are available to the whole of the County Borough.
We work with several local partners to provide services for young people who have been excluded from mainstream education and adults with learning difficulties. Our partners include Job Centre Plus, Department for Work and Pensions, Careers Wales and the council's Education and Social Services Departments, all of which refer people to us. We are also grateful for support from local schools and colleges.
Services we can offer
Fast Forward looks after people referred here from other partner organisations. Depending on the nature of that referral, we can offer any or all of the following:
- State of the art Community Digilab (IT suite)
- Individual Jobsearch and supported CV writing
- The opportunity to build on existing skills such as Maths, English, IT and team working
- Nationally recognised qualifications, including City and Guilds and Open College Network (OCN)
- Work-based placements
- Practical experience in environmental and community-based projects
- An alternative learning programme for 13-16 year olds
